Improved biotransformations on charged PEGA supports.

Alessandra Basso, Luigi De Martin, Lucia Gardossi, Graham Margetts, Ian Brazendale, Annie Y Bosma, Rein V Ulijn, Sabine L Flitsch

Index: Chem. Commun. (Camb.) (11) , 1296-7, (2003)

Full Text: HTML

Abstract

PEGA supports functionalised with permanent charges show superior swelling properties in aqueous media when compared to neutral PEGA; a novel positively charged PEGA resin significantly improves penicillin G amidase (PGA) catalysed biotransformation on solid support, by favouring accessibility of the negatively charged enzyme.
